Rear end click
 
I know this has been covered, but a clunk is what I have seen discussed, but I get a click! When I shift into reverse, I hear a slight click from the rear end when I start to move. Also if I am on a hill and a stand still and start to go I hear it sometimes. Was wondering if anyone getting this, I am feeling this is normal.

Brett@ImportPartsPro 03-21-2011 10:04 AM

There was actually a TSB for this same noise on the Z33. The "fix" involved putting a bit of moly based grease on the axle flanges where they contact the stub shafts out of the diff.
